  • Blueprint takes you behind the scenes of the Toronto Maple Leafs 2024 Development camp. Led by Hayley Wickenheiser, the camp hosted 46 players including 17 total draft picks with 6 players from the 2024 NHL Draft. Fraser Minten & Easton Cowan return in the blue and white, joined by 2024 first round pick, Ben Danford.
